    Cold damage comes from some Crey enemies, Outcasts in the Chiller line, and Ice Thorn Casters. I may be missing some, but I do recall hearing that cold is the rarest damage type in the game. Which means that being the best at it is, if you'll pardon the phrase, cold comfort at best.

    To the best of my knowledge, none of the Ice powers provide defense to Psionic. Any edge Ice may have over Invulnerability against Psionics would be due just to the reduced attack frequency (which won't be as good once the damage debuff happens, but I'm assuming that the damage debuff will be enough to result in a net decrease in incoming damage).

    Did Toxic defense finally get implemented? If not, then any protection we've got is coming from Hoarfrost.

    Energy and Negative Energy don't have any clouds attached to their silver linings, but since Invulnerability is better than Ice against smash and lethal (the most common damage types, as you said), and we're completely naked against fire now that two of our three sources of protection from it have been gutted and the third offers only token resistance, I think ice is still trailing behind.
